would agree 2800+ is a waste, a 2500+ will overclock to 3200+ speeds so easily, it souldn't even be called an overclock.
The money you save should be spent on PC3200 memory, or a 9800 Non Pro.
BTW, Abit NF-7 is 79$, 20$ cheaper than the MSI, and is a better Overclocking board.
You mentioned 512 Kingston (87$), only 1 stick? Nforce boards work better with 2 sticks, it then utilizes Dual Channel, and that will give you better memory bandwidth.
Geil is a little bit cheaper, and performs as well or better than Kingston, You can get 2 sticks of PC3200 for 43$ a peice (86$)

Just showing you a few options you might not have looked at, should run faster and save you some money, what more can you ask for

EDIT

The stock HSF will be fine at 3200+ speeds, you can upgrade down the road if you aren't happy with the temps (stay under 50c)
You only shorten a cpu's life if you go crazy with the voltage, stay under 1.8volts and you will be fine. It will become obsolete long before it would ever die
